## Pagination checks

The Corvette-free public API for Tidemark returns results in pages of 100 via cursor tokens. Never assume page counts are stable; items can shift between requests. When verifying a customer report, walk the cursor chain until `next` is null and compare totals against the internal Ledgerpine reconciliation endpoint. Contractors should use the staging host only. Requests to the reconciliation endpoint are authenticated with the internal service key that appears immediately below this paragraph.

API key for kahop-bagef: zpat2_yb

Finance Review Summary — Ostrel Basin Expansion

Capex for the Ostrel Basin entry: within budget. Lease costs for the Drayfield depot ran 6 percent over forecast; offset by lower fit-out spend. Revenue ramp tracking to plan; breakeven expected month fourteen. Working-capital draw peaked lower than modelled. Two hires deferred to next quarter. Branch managers should note freight rates remain the main variable. No further approvals required at this stage. Strategic outlook is noted below.

internal memo for kawip-hadug: Headcount on the Wenwyn team goes from 7 to 140 by the end of January. Gross margin on Wenwyn came in at 20 percent against a plan of 15 percent.

Visitors must never be left unattended in the first-aid room on Level 2 of Marrowgate House. Assistants should log each visit in the welfare register, remain within earshot, and restock any used supplies afterwards via Facilities at Quillbrook Systems. Should the door lock engage behind you, re-enter using the code provided below.

staff pass of kawip-hawef = bdg-QLP-2

- Replaced the hourly interpolation with harmonic constituents pulled from the Marrow Bay dataset, reducing predicted-height error near slack tide.
- Fixed the widget showing yesterday's table when the device crosses a timezone boundary after midnight.
- Added a configurable datum offset for harbors that publish charts against local datums.
- Cached tide tables now expire after 14 days instead of never.

Reviewers should focus on the datum math in `tide_datum.rs`. Questions on the harmonic model go to the author of record, named below.

named custodian: Brivan Eliath Quenox Frador